目的 研究不同批号蕲蛇酶静脉给予家兔后 ,对血液凝固系统各项指标的影响 ,以判定其药效的稳定性。 方法 取家兔 ,纯白色 ,体重 1.5~ 2 .5kg,雌雄兼用。每日静脉注入蕲蛇酶 1.0 u/kg.d- 1,连用 3~ 5天 ;药前、药后从心脏取血 6 m l,取全血 1m l作血栓形成 ;余血以 3.0 %枸橼酸钠按 1:9抗凝 ,分离富血小板血浆 ( PRP) ,测定其血小板数目和血小板聚集率。以贫血小板血浆 ( PPP)测定凝血酶时间( TT)、凝血酶原时间 ( PT)、部分凝血活酶时间 ( KPTT)以及纤维蛋白原 ( Fg)含量。 结果 5个批号的蕲蛇酶药后 3天或 5天均可明显使血栓形成的重量减轻 ,长度缩短 ,Fg含量减少 ( P <0 .0 1) ,TT、PT、 KPTT均延长 ( P <0 .0 5~ 0 .0 1) ;血小板数轻度减少 ,聚集率抑制达 2 0 %~ 50 %。 结论 不同批号的蕲蛇酶静脉给予家兔 ,具有显著的作用于血液凝固系统 ,导致血栓形成减少 ,表明对心脑血管内血栓形成药效学相同 。
Objective Studies on the biological activities of various batches of the acutobin on rabbit's blood coagulation system for evaluating the effectiveness of the drug Methods White color rabbits,1 5~2 5 kg were used; Acutobin 1 0U/kg d iv for 3~5 days consecutive Before and after the acutobin was given, blood of 6ml samples were drawn by heart puncture First, 1ml blood for thrombosis determined, then the remain blood ( 5ml ) were prepared for PRP by adding 3 0% sodium citrate(1:9) and centrifuging The Platelets number and aggregation of platelets were determined Thrombin time ( TT ), prothrombin time (PT), Kaolin partial thromboplastin time (KPTT) and fibrinogen level of the PPP were determined Results After intravenous injected the five batches of acutobin for 3~5 days respectively, all the experimental animals of five groups showed same positive effects The thrombosis and fibrinogen level were diminished The TT, PT and KPTT were prolong The platelets number minimal decreased and the aggregation of platelet was inhibited Conclusion Applicaton of rabbits to assay the biological effects of acutobin is necessary and practical
